Assignment
Create a visual DISSONANCE — an image where elements clash intentionally, like a dissonant chord in music. Complementary colors at maximum saturation, conflicting scales, contradictory textures — all creating productive visual tension that is uncomfortable but compelling.
Criteria: Multiple visual clashes present (color, scale, texture). Clashes are clearly intentional, not accidental. Image is uncomfortable but compositionally unified. At least 3 types of visual dissonance identifiable.
Intents
- Place jagged, geometric shards of pure saturated cyan directly beside organic, swirling forms in saturated red-orange, so color and shape clash forcefully.
- Layer a rough, impasto texture in some sections against glossy, almost airbrushed flatness in others, so the texture contrast is unmistakable.
- Present a tiny, hyper-detailed labyrinth pattern clashing in one quadrant with a massive, blurry, amorphous color field, to create scale dissonance.
- Arrange two opposing directional rhythms: harsh, staccato vertical marks cutting through a flowing, horizontal wash, their intersection creating visual tension.
- Deliberately disrupt compositional harmony by forcing the most saturated color collisions (cyan and red-orange) to abut across a “seam” of unresolved, vibrating purple-gray negative space.
